Abstract:
The study was carried out to investigate the breeding habits and the changes of morphological character during the embryonic development of Picasso clownfish. The fish was cultured to mature and spawn in artificial condition. The results showed that the process of embryonic development includes zygote stage, cleavage stage, blastula stage, blastoderm stage, gastrula, neurula stage, organogenesis stage and hatching stage. About 300~600 eggs were produced each time and the fertilized eggs were attached to the earthen pot. The color of the embryo is orangeyellow and the adhesive fertilized eggs, which were ellipsoidal,were 2.2±0.1 mm long and 0.92±0.10mm in diameter. It took about 217 h to complete the whole incubation period at 26±1℃.
